Key Findings
The U.S. Food and Drug Administration (FDA) has selected Dexcom, a leading continuous glucose monitor (CGM) company, as the inaugural participant in its new digital health pilot program, ‘Technology-Enabled Meaningful Patient Outcomes (TEMPO).’ Through this groundbreaking program, Dexcom plans to deploy an AI-enabled glucose health program, integrating real-time data from its flagship products, Dexcom G7 and Stelo, with contextual health information such as diet, exercise, sleep, and stress.
Technical and Clinical Details
Within the TEMPO pilot program, Dexcom’s AI technology will analyze vast amounts of glucose data collected from both the prescription-based G7 and the OTC-approved Stelo CGMs. This data will be combined with lifestyle information such as user nutrition intake, physical activity levels, sleep patterns, and stress factors, enabling a more comprehensive understanding of individual patient metabolic profiles. The AI algorithms will detect patterns and trends from this integrated information to identify risks for prediabetes and Type 2 diabetes at an early stage. Furthermore, for healthcare professionals, the program will provide personalized insights into patient health status and recommendations to support individualized intervention strategies. This is expected to empower clinicians to make more data-driven decisions and optimize patient health outcomes.
Background and Industry Context
Digital health technologies are recognized for their potential to fundamentally transform healthcare delivery. The FDA’s TEMPO program is a crucial initiative to evaluate how such innovative technologies can contribute to meaningful patient outcomes and to shape future regulatory frameworks. While CGM technology, pioneered by companies like Dexcom, has revolutionized diabetes management, its data has traditionally been limited to glucose monitoring. By integrating CGM data with broader health contexts through AI, the application of these technologies for early disease screening, prevention, and personalized medicine is accelerated. This signals the advent of an era where digital biomarkers and AI become mainstream in healthcare.
Strategic Significance and Outlook
Dexcom’s selection for the TEMPO pilot program further solidifies its leadership in the digital health sector and expands the applicability of CGM technology from managing diagnosed diabetes patients to broader public health initiatives, particularly early detection and prevention of prediabetes and Type 2 diabetes. The program’s success could pave the way for the FDA to offer similar expedited approval pathways to other digital health companies in the future. This is expected to accelerate the proliferation of AI-driven personal health programs, fostering a future where individuals can more actively manage their health and prevent or delay the progression of chronic diseases through proactive interventions. This marks a significant step towards patient-centered preventive medicine.
